检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
功能总览 功能总览 全部 购买实例 实例管理 安装和实例化链代码 证书和SDK配置文件管理 联盟链管理 通道管理 插件管理 合约仓库 API 链代码开发 运维监控 全部 虚拟私有云 子网 路由表 虚拟IP IPv4/IPv6双栈 安全组 网络ACL 弹性公网IP 共享带宽 共享流量包
5-1h内退回原账号。 问题现象 实例创建失败,提示删除Kube资源失败,创建实例过程中集群状态异常。 解决方案 方案一:排查集群状态是否正常。 在“云容器引擎”控制台的“集群管理”页面查看集群状态。 集群状态正常请重新购买;若集群状态异常,请提工单进行咨询。 方案二:创建BCS实例时选择其他已有集群。
SFS资源包”,创建文件系统请参考:创建文件系统。 购买CCE集群: 登录CCE控制台,在云容器引擎界面单击“购买Kubernetes集群”,操作步骤请参考:快速创建Kubernetes集群。 集群中导入SFS: 在“云容器引擎”界面左侧导航栏选择“资源管理”>“存储管理”>“文
peer节点频繁重启,报PanicDB not exist 进入peer容器,进入“/home/paas/evs/baas/{服务ID}/{容器ID}/”路径,删除production文件夹。 重启peer与agent容器,重新拉取账本并进行加通道操作。 父主题: 使用类问题
5-1h内退回原账号。 问题现象 实例创建时,提示创建集群失败。 解决方案 首先创建集群,然后在购买BCS实例时选择创建成功的目标集群: 登录CCE控制台,在云容器引擎界面单击“购买Kubernetes集群”,操作步骤请参考:快速创建Kubernetes集群。 父主题: 具体报错排查
获取全部通知 功能介绍 获取全部通知 调试 您可以在API Explorer中调试该接口,支持自动认证鉴权。API Explorer可以自动生成SDK代码示例,并提供SDK代码示例调试功能。 URI GET /v2/{project_id}/notifications 表1 路径参数
exit 1 fi if type docker > /dev/null 2>&1; then echo "Docker exists!" else echo "No docker, please install docker before start this demo"
CCE服务异常 退费说明 实例创建失败,已扣除费用会在0.5-1h内退回原账号。 问题现象 实例创建失败,提示CCE服务异常。 解决方案 创建CCE集群,在购买BCS实例时选择已有目标集群: 登录CCE控制台,在云容器引擎界面单击“购买Kubernetes集群”,操作步骤请参考:快速创建Kubernetes集群。
检查CCE集群状态超时 退费说明 实例创建失败,已扣除费用会在0.5-1h内退回原账号。 问题现象 实例创建失败,检查CCE集群状态超时。 解决方案 方案一:重新创建BCS实例时切换可用区。 若还是失败,请提工单咨询。 方案二:先创建集群,然后在创建BCS实例时选择已有集群。 创建集群:
2版本后,在AOM页面试图查看链代码容器日志,但找不到链代码容器对应的日志文件。 根本原因 目前非Fabric v2.2版本的BCS实例使用Kubernetes拉起链代码容器,而Fabric v2.2版本的BCS实例使用的是原生Docker拉起链代码容器,与Hyperledger开源社
执行以下命令,检查docker容器是否安装成功。 docker version 显示如下回显信息,表示docker容器安装成功。 图1 结果显示信息 配置Docker代理。 创建目录和文件。 mkdir /etc/systemd/system/docker.service.d vim
日志 > 日志文件 > 主机”,选择全部自定义集群。 选择记录的节点IP,单击“查看”,查看节点日志。 图8 查看对应的节点日志 单击“开启实时查看”,实时查看运维日志。 图9 实时查看运维日志 后台虚拟机查看运维日志(CCE集群) 在“云容器引擎 > 工作负载”页面查看节点名称
查看失败节点的name 登录实例所在CCE集群下的所有节点(节点需绑定弹性IP),执行“docker ps |grep name”命令(如下图所示),查询到的前缀为k8s_peer(如果查询的是orderer则是k8s_orderer)的容器即为触发告警的容器,最前方为对应的容器ID。 图2 查看回显结果
问题现象 实例创建失败,提示subnet子网不可用。 解决方案 先创建集群,之后购买BCS实例时选择已有目标集群。 创建集群: 登录CCE控制台,在云容器引擎界面单击“购买Kubernetes集群”,操作步骤请参考:快速创建Kubernetes集群。 父主题: 具体报错排查
停止计费 当在区块链服务中,删除Hyperledger Fabric增强版实例时,已勾选删除容器集群(CCE),区块链服务将停止计费。
选择ECDSA,组织数量和名称使用默认配置。 修改链码容器版本。 选择实例管理,单击打算安装同态加密链代码的实例的容器集群。 单击工作负载页签,切换到对应集群,编辑peer负载的yaml文件。 修改CORE_PEER_CCENV_IMAGE_NAME的版本号为3.0.5。 安装并实例化链代码。
/tmp/test(容器内路径) 各peer容器需要选择相同路径。并且请记录各peer所挂载的路径,BCS实例版本升级后,容器内原挂载路径将会失效,需要重新挂载原网盘至原有路径(已转储的数据不会丢失,保留在网盘中,重新挂载后即可恢复)。 权限 读写 等待容器应用重启,实例数变为1/1后,表示重启成功,磁盘挂载成功。
版本信息 显示版本信息。 共识节点 共识信息,显示正常组织数量和全部组织数量。 记账节点 实例节点的信息,显示组织和实例的数量详情。 代理节点 代理的信息,显示正常组织数量和全部组织数量。 插件 插件数量信息。例如:1/2表示全部实例2个,正常1个。 在区块链实例管理页面,您可以执行如表2下管理操作。
登录部署BCS区块链的云服务器,并执行docker ps|grep k8s_peer指令查看peer容器,记录交易超时的peer节点容器ID。 图4 查看peer容器 执行docker exec -it {容器ID} bash进入容器。 图5 进入容器 执行peer channel list查看peer节点加入的通道。
已生成的智能合约。通过对生成的智能合约选择背书策略、安装合约的组织等配置,完成合约的安装和实例化,智能合约最终运行在背书节点中的一个Docker容器内。 智能合约触发 实例化后的智能合约,可以通过外部条件来触发合约执行过程,支持事件触发和交易触发的方式,两种模式均会触发背书节点进行一致性共识,避免恶意节点作恶。